I think I shall place my appreciation to Daljeet and Abhas for their roles and of course the CVs. Most of us would agree here that Anjali is dumb, Shyam is a creep and Dadi is being a nonsense by jumping right left and centre to wrong conclusions. I was shocked in a few episodes back at how Anjali would want to have a son like Shyam and not a girl like herself. And the way Shyam is portrayed as someone who makes a sweet face in front of some one and at the same time is cheating and leaving off his wife and is trying to take all the property of his brother in law, and makes advances to his Khushi when her husband is absent scared me. However the fact here is what they have shown us is a creeping reality show which we see around us all the time.
India is one of the last countries on earth where Dowry is a norm and as Payal said in one of the earlier episodes is a hunger that is never quenched. Violence also is something that only gets worse with time and we should never let a criminal go scot free like Arnav did. Or hide a crime as Khushi did. Or think that a man can do anything when his wife is pregnant and will be considered a misunderstanding as Dadi is now. Shyam has only very limited access to Raizada mention and with that he is already trying to harm Anjali. When he was there he tried to hurt Anjali and the child once by making her fall and instead of being happy that he is a father he was sad that Khushi is some one else's wife. No child would want a father like that.
Let us now come away from the life of fiction and to the world of reality. I am assuming all those reading are at least upper middle class or higher. Are married or going to be. Can we really say that we have not seen people like Shyam and Anjali around us. We may not have to go beyond our own close family. How many out their can say that their brother or father did not take a dowry or their husband was not given anything after marriage which was beyond the capacity of the male in question's income. How many of us have parents and brothers who will give their daughter's and sister's husband anything they demand?
So should actually appreciate IPKKND of the way it is showing us that what was done was wrong. Because the ones who give over the top gifts are the ones who end up in trouble. Those boys will not only rarely develop a backbone but are the ones who go back to the in laws for more and more.
Hope by seeing this events at least one of us will not ask their parents or brothers to give things for their husband which the husband can not afford on his own. You can ask for yourself, because you have full right. At the same time not think that a Husband is a God as the popular Dadi thinks.
Enjoy your weekend. Tolerating a crime is also a crime. Not letting a criminal face the justice system is also a crime.
